How much does a Technical Director make?
A Technical Director often earns a strong salary that reflects their expertise and leadership in technical fields. On average, a Technical Director makes about $156,258 per year. This figure can vary based on experience, industry, and location. For instance, those in tech hubs or high-demand sectors may see higher earnings.
The salary range for a Technical Director can be quite broad. At the lower end, some may earn around $37,986, while at the higher end, salaries can reach up to $277,500. This wide range shows the potential for growth and advancement in the role. Many factors influence these numbers, including the size of the company, the complexity of projects, and the director's specific skill set.

How to earn more as a Technical Director?
A Technical Director can increase their earnings by focusing on several key areas. These areas not only enhance skills but also make a candidate more attractive to potential employers. One important factor is gaining advanced certifications. These certifications can validate expertise and open up higher-paying opportunities. Another factor is taking on leadership roles in projects. Leading teams and managing projects successfully can lead to higher salaries and bonuses. Networking with industry professionals also plays a crucial role. Building a strong professional network can lead to new job opportunities and salary negotiations.
Additionally, staying updated with the latest technology trends is essential. Keeping skills current ensures competitiveness in the job market. Finally, seeking out mentorship can provide valuable insights and career advice. Mentors can help navigate the path to higher earnings. By focusing on these factors, a Technical Director can significantly improve their earning potential.
